We are going to IOA and staying at HRH this August for the first time. Here's what I know so far:

We used our Entertainment card and booked our rooms at HRH for $117.50 a night. By staying at HRH, we can use our room keys in IOA for FOTL privileges -- much better than Disney's fastpass from what I understand.

I also read somewhere that we can show our room key at the restaurants on CityWalk and don't have to make reservations -- of course someone can correct me on this one if I'm wrong! I think you need reservations at Emeril's regardless.

The pool at HRH is a somewhat shallow (only 4 feet or something like that) compared to others but from what I read it appears to be well liked by the kids. Apparently there is a slide and you can hear the music under the water.

The rooms at HRH are a little smaller than PBH. PBH has a more relaxing feel -- HRH is simply-stated the Hard Rock Hotel...its all in the name.

As far as citywalk: with your hotel key you get to go to the "head of the line" for people without reservations. This cut our wait at Margaritaville from 1 hr to 20 min. Of course, it would be quicker still to make res. though.

At Emeril's, you always need reservations. And months ahead is not too soon if you want to eat there for supper.

Hotel discounts: Annual Passholders, AAA, travel agent, entertainment card, airline employee, fan club card, mmm..have I missed any?
